DEPT Agency takes gold at straight 8 shootout 2026
Raw London and Siren Music complete the podium, while DROOL Productions picks up the Audience Award.
DEPT Agency has taken gold at the straight 8 shootout 2026 for Love You to Death, with the winners revealed at a screening at London’s Prince Charles Cinema.
The event brought the competition’s Super 8 shorts back to the big screen following their first showing in Cannes, giving the participating companies another chance to see the films before the results were announced.
Each entrant was challenged to create a two-and-a-half-minute film on a single cartridge of Super 8, shooting every scene in story order with no retakes, editing or post-production. As Super 8 does not record sound, the original soundtracks were also created without the filmmakers seeing the developed footage.

Raw London received silver for Party Wall, while Siren Music took bronze with Cat Cracks the Case. DROOL Productions’ Eye Test received the Audience Award, determined by the loudest response in the room from a film not already awarded a trophy.
Voting took place in Cannes, with each participating company selecting its first, second and third choices, excluding its own entry. The winners received bespoke Super 8 camera trophies created by model and SFX company MACHINESHOP.
The shootout is presented by Cinelab Film & Digital and supported by the APA, shots, Kodak and MACHINESHOP. The screenings also featured four films selected from the open straight 8 competition, which had previously played at the Cannes Film Festival in May.
Both the open straight 8 competition and the 2027 shootout are now accepting entries, with places in the latter limited to 25 companies.
